rhythm
A regular, recurring sequence of sounds, movements, or stresses, especially in music and dance.
Das Schlagzeug gibt den treibenden Rhythmus des Liedes vor.
The drums set the driving rhythm of the song.

Pay attention to the unusual spelling, which comes from Greek: 'Rh' at the beginning and 'th' in the middle. This is a common source of mistakes when writing.
Der richtige Rhythmus ist beim Tanzen sehr wichtig.
The right rhythm is very important when dancing.
The expressions 'aus dem Rhythmus kommen' (to get out of rhythm) and 'jemanden aus dem Rhythmus bringen' (to throw someone off their rhythm) are very common. They mean that you get confused or that a familiar routine is disrupted.
Die ständigen Unterbrechungen haben mich komplett aus dem Rhythmus gebracht.
The constant interruptions completely threw me off my rhythm.
In music, the rhythm is often described with adjectives such as 'schnell' (fast), 'langsam' (slow), or 'treibend' (driving). You can 'den Rhythmus vorgeben' (set the rhythm), 'halten' (keep it), or 'mitklatschen' (clap along).
Alle klatschten im Rhythmus der Musik.
Everyone clapped to the rhythm of the music.
For biological or everyday cycles, 'Rhythmus' (rhythm) is often used in compound words, for example 'Schlafrhythmus' (sleep rhythm) or 'Tagesrhythmus' (daily rhythm).
Nach der Reise musste ich meinen Schlafrhythmus erst wiederfinden.
After the trip, I first had to get my sleep rhythm back.

'Tempo' and 'Rhythmus' can both describe how something unfolds, especially in music, dance, or movement. 'Tempo' refers to speed: something is fast or slow. 'Rhythmus' refers to a regular pattern, for example beats, movements, or processes that repeat. The words can be confused because a fast rhythm often also has a high tempo. A practical tip: ask 'How fast?' for 'Tempo' and 'What pattern?' for 'Rhythmus'.

Die Tänzerin findet den Rhythmus sofort und bewegt sich sicher zur Musik.
The dancer finds the rhythm right away and moves confidently to the music.
Beim Laufen hat Max das Tempo erhöht, weil er den Bus noch erreichen wollte.
While running, Max increased his speed because he still wanted to catch the bus.
